UPI Goes Global: A New Chapter in Cross-Border Payments

One of the most exciting “UPI news today” updates revolves around its expanding international footprint. Following successful integrations in countries like Singapore, Bhutan, and Nepal, UPI has recently marked significant milestones in its global journey. France has become the first European country to adopt UPI for merchant payments, starting with the iconic Eiffel Tower. Furthermore, the recent launch of UPI services in Sri Lanka and Mauritius is a testament to its growing appeal as a secure, efficient, and cost-effective cross-border payment solution, especially for remittances and tourism. This global push is transforming how Indian travelers and the diaspora transact abroad.

Innovation at its Core: New Features Enhancing User Experience

Innovation remains central to UPI’s evolution. Recent developments include features designed to make transactions even more seamless and accessible. ‘UPI Lite X’ offers an offline payment mode, perfect for areas with limited internet connectivity, while the ‘Credit Line on UPI’ feature allows users to access pre-sanctioned credit lines directly through their UPI apps, blending credit access with the convenience of UPI payments. Additionally, “Tap & Pay” functionality is making contactless merchant payments faster and more convenient, akin to tap-and-go card payments but powered by UPI.
